Well, the current Marketplace uses XML-based data files not related to HTML. It's unlikely that MS would build a Web browser for this reason. The Zune also already has an advanced UI framework on-board that is almost certainly being used to display the Marketplace storefront.

What might be possible is, once the update is out,
connect the zune to your home network and try to browse the marketplace while monitoring what sites get accessed on your network. After that find out how/what the zune reads to get the the marketplace listings. Then just forward anything that tries to access that site to somewhere else. It might not be able to go to websites but if you can recreate the file it reads for the marketplace, you might be able to create a simple rss reader
